Marcus Camby, it seems, may just be back in time to face his ex-team the New York Knicks after all.  According to Marc Spears of the Denver Post Camby has pencilled in the Nuggets game against the Washington Wizards - the game proceeding the Knicks clash - as the possible comeback game for Camby.

"With my first game back being rusty, I wouldn't want (New York) to be my first game," Camby said. "I probably want to start out playing on the road. Hopefully, I'll know something (this) week. It's pretty hard to get practices because the games are coming so rapidly."

While Camby previously had a goal to play in New York, it's not as important to the center now.

"There's not a sense of urgency to play against them," Camby said. "We play them again (April 2)."
